Transaction 259fd5a2c712f52dcd57480a64a68704ce3debc121e938f23a7551ffa38ca8c2

1 Input
2 Outputs
  • 259fd5a2c712f52dcd57480a64a68704ce3debc121e938f23a7551ffa38ca8c2:0
  • value  1529762
    address  3HJMnDXfey8aVXNiWvrdaLWq8r2JDD39w8
  • 259fd5a2c712f52dcd57480a64a68704ce3debc121e938f23a7551ffa38ca8c2:1
  • value  21853161
    address  3M8XPz4UVfniZrPvgGgqwMojLw2Nw741EF